Abstract

Porous silica powder and transparent porous silica were synthesized for the development of thermal insulating materials and their thermal conductivity was evaluated. It was clarified that the thermal conductivity of the porous ceramic material was lowered than that of simple vacuum at lower vacuum region (higher pressure), indicating the porous ceramic materials had an advantage for the application of thermal insulator.
